1. A tracheal tube comprising:
- a hollow tube body configured to be inserted into a subject;
a lumen mounted to the tube body; and
a scope unit including a cable portion inserted in the lumen and an imaging optical system mounted to a distal end of the cable portion, the imaging optical system including an imaging device configured to image an inside of the subject,the imaging optical system includingan imaging device module including the imaging device and an objective lens mounted in front of an imaging surface of the imaging device, andan illumination optical system configured to illuminate the inside of the subject,the illumination optical system including at least two light-guide fibers configured to guide a light beam from a light source to the inside of the subject,the at least two light-guide fibers being mounted around the imaging device module,the at least two light-guide fibers having obliquely cut flat emitting surfaces that are inclined with respect to a light-guide fiber optical axis,the emitting surfaces are arranged such that an optical axis of each light beam emitted from the emitting surfaces is directed in a direction away from a distal end surface of the imaging device module, to reduce entrance of each light beam emitted from the emitting surfaces into the distal end surface of the imaging device module,the two light guide fibers are mounted across the imaging device module and;
the cable portion of the scope unit is bonded anal fixed to the tube body at a proximal end side and a distal end side of the lumen.

Abstract
Provided is a tracheal tube that can be easily inserted into the inside of a subject and enables real-time observation of a state after tracheal intubation. The tracheal tube (1) includes a hollow tube body (2), a lumen (2a), and a scope unit (3), wherein the tube body (2) is inserted into the subject, the lumen (2a) is mounted to the tube body (2), and the scope unit (3) includes a cable portion (4) inserted in the lumen (2a) and an imaging optical system mounted to the distal end of the cable portion (4), the imaging optical system including an imaging device configured to image the inside of the subject.
